Comprehending the Causes of Broken Windows
Before delving into repair processes, it's crucial to comprehend what commonly causes window damage. Acknowledging these causes can likewise assist homeowner in enhancing preventive procedures. Here is a list of some typical causes of broken windows:
Accidental Impact: Glass can break due to unintentional collisions, such as a ball being tossed or objects being dropped.Severe Weather: Extreme weather, consisting of hail, high winds, and heavy snowfall, can harm windows.Aging Materials: Over time, windows might establish weak points due to rust, rot, or other age-related degeneration.Burglary: Unfortunately, windows may be broken during attempted break-ins.Thermal Stress: Rapid temperature changes can trigger the glass to broaden or agreement, resulting in fractures.Examining the Damage
Before carrying out repairs, it's crucial to examine the degree of the damage. Windows can suffer numerous kinds of damage, including:
Cracks: Minor surface-level fractures often do not need full replacement but require prompt attention to avoid more damage.Shattered Glass: This scenario usually needs complete panel replacement.Frame Damage: If the window frame is split or warped, this may need attending to individually from the glass.Repair Methods1. Patch Repair
For minor fractures, a spot repair may suffice. This procedure includes:
Cleaning the damaged area.Using clear epoxy or a glass adhesive.Allowing it to treat according to the maker's directions.
Please note that patches are momentary and might not restore the window's initial stability.
2. Caulking
In many cases, windows might appear broken due to seal failures rather than physical damage. This typically leads to foggy or cloudy appearances. To bring back clearness, follow these actions:
Remove any old caulk and debris around the window edges.Clean surface areas with alcohol.Apply a fresh bead of silicone-caulk around the window boundary.3. Glass Replacement
When the glass is shattered, replacement is necessary. Here's a basic summary of the procedure:
Remove the harmed window by unscrewing or prying out the old frame.Step the dimensions of the glass to cut a brand-new piece accurately.Protect brand-new glass into the window frame with glazing substance or putty.Finish with a careful application of caulking.4. Frame Replacement
If the frame is damaged, more considerable repairs or replacements may be essential:
Remove the old frame and thoroughly check nearby structures.Install a new frame, repairing it safely.Re-install the glass panel and use the required seals.Expense Considerations
The cost of broken window repair can differ widely based on several aspects, consisting of:
Type of Damage: Minor repairs will normally cost less than complete replacements.Product: The type of glass and frame product substantially affect the rate.Labor Costs: Hiring experts incurs additional costs compared to DIY tasks.Average Repair CostsType of RepairApproximated Cost RangeSpot Repairs₤ 50 - ₤ 100Caulking₤ 30 - ₤ 75Glass Replacement₤ 200 - ₤ 400Frame Replacement₤ 300 - ₤ 600
Keep in mind: These quotes can differ based on area and specific job requirements.

2. How long does a broken window repair normally take?
The timeline depends upon the degree of the damage. Patch repairs may take a few hours, while complete replacements may need a day or more.
3. Is it worth repairing old windows?
If the frames remain in great condition, repairing may be more affordable than changing. However, older windows might justify a complete replacement for increased effectiveness.
4. What tools do I need for a DIY window repair?
Basic toolkit products such as an energy knife, determining tape, hammer, and security goggles will suffice for minor repairs. For glass replacement, additional tools like glazier points and a glass cutter may be needed.
